How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Jamestown High Point?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Jamestown High Point Studio Apartments | $1,075 | $700 | $2,609 |
Jamestown High Point 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,287 | $650 | $2,784 |
Jamestown High Point 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,452 | $850 | $3,285 |
Jamestown High Point 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,858 | $1,025 | $4,269 |
Jamestown High Point 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,300 | $2,085 | $2,560 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Jamestown High Point
How much are Studio apartments in Jamestown High Point?
There are currently 14 Studio Apartments in Jamestown High Point with rent ranges from $700 to $2,609 with an average price of $1,075.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Jamestown High Point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Jamestown High Point ranges from $650 to $2,784 with an average monthly rent of $1,287.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Jamestown High Point c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Jamestown High Point range from $850 to $3,285.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,452.
How expensive are Jamestown High Point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 70 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Jamestown High Point on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,025 to $4,269 - averaging $1,858 for the location.
